2016-09-04 3 views
-2

로컬 컴퓨터에서 새 터미널 (기존 터미널의 동일/새 탭이 아님)에서 유닉스 셸 (bash)에서 기존 vim 파일을 여는 방법은 무엇입니까?새로운 유닉스 터미널에서 vim 파일 열기

또한 vim에서 새로운 터미널 (기존 터미널의 새 탭과 동일하지 않음)에 파일을 분할하는 방법이 있습니까?

답변

-1

이 시도 :

vim [your file] 

을이 당신을 위해 작동하지 않는 경우, 당신은 그것을가 설치되어 있는지 확인하십시오 : 당신이 vim 이미 경우

:edit [your file] 

sudo apt-get install vim 

+0

어떻게 새 단말기에서 열 수 있습니까? –

+0

새 터미널 창을 열지 않습니다. – Hong

1

새 터미널을 여는 방법은 플랫폼에 따라 다릅니다. 이것은 실제로 vim 자체와는 전혀 관련이 없습니다.

예를 들어 GNOME을 사용하는 경우 gnome-terminal -e "vim $filename" & disown을 실행하면됩니다. 새로운 터미널을 시작하고 명령을 실행하는 방법을 찾으려면 사용중인 터미널 에뮬레이터의 설명서를 찾아보십시오.

또 다른 (훨씬 더 나은) 해결책은 당신이 터미널에서 정력을 돌릴 아주 좋은 이유가 없다면, 이런 상황을 위해 GVim을 단순히 사용하는 것입니다 (만약 당신이 이것을 ssh로 돌리면 어쨌든 작동하지 않을 것입니다. 이 경우 화면 또는 tmux와 같은 터미널 멀티플렉서를 사용하는 것이 좋습니다.


추 신 : bash는 터미널 (에뮬레이터)이 아닙니다. bash는 쉘입니다. bash의 새로운 인스턴스를 실행하면 동일한 터미널에서 실행됩니다. 원하는 터미널이 아닌 것입니다.

관련 문제